Transaction
c04a63afda2011259f8f00ed7a2b9aebe9a5d0a477eecfa70dd6c39a96394bcc

Block
Time
8/17/2020 12:15:09 AM
Version
1
Size
123 B
Confirmations
2235388

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
40 VEIL